Description

Nestled in the picturesque Marple Bridge, this beautifully presented detached Dorma bungalow offers an ideal blend of modern living and comfort. Featuring a spacious, open-plan kitchen with a sleek breakfast bar and cozy living area complete with a charming log burner, this home is perfect for both family gatherings and quiet evenings.

The well-equipped utility room adds convenience, while the large living room with formal dining area offers the perfect setting for entertaining. Step through to the bright and airy conservatory, where you can enjoy panoramic views of the meticulously landscaped rear garden, a serene oasis ideal for alfresco dining or simply unwinding.

The ground floor also features a generously sized main bedroom with fitted wardrobes, a second double bedroom, and a single bedroom currently serving as a stylish office. The family bathroom, designed with modern touches, completes the layout.

Upstairs, the first floor hosts a delightful double bedroom with dual-aspect windows, flooding the room with natural light, along with a shower room for added luxury.

The property also benefits from a garage and private driveway, offering ample parking space. Perfectly positioned within walking distance of Marple train station, the home provides a quick and easy commute into Manchester, while being within the catchment area of excellent local schools.

This is a property that offers style, convenience, and the perfect blend of modern living in a tranquil, sought-after location. A must-see!

Rent-driven metrics

Based on Area rent estimate.

Rent ratio 0.16%
Max investor price (0.8%) £136,875
Target investor price (1%) £109,500
  • Rent ratio — Monthly rent ÷ purchase price (1% rule). 1%+ = strong, 0.8–1% = okay, <0.8% = weak for cashflow.
  • Max investor price — Rent ÷ 0.8%; the price at which rent would be 0.8% of price (Stoke-style target).
  • Target investor price — Rent ÷ 1%; the price at which rent would be 1% of price (strong cashflow band).
  • Gross yield — Annual rent as % of purchase price (no costs).
